#7faec0 - Glacier Hex Color Code

#7FAEC0 (Glacier) - RGB 127, 174, 192 Color Information

#7faec0 Conversion Table

HEX Triplet 7F, AE, C0
RGB Decimal 127, 174, 192
RGB Octal 177, 256, 300
RGB Percent 49.8%, 68.2%, 75.3%
RGB Binary 1111111, 10101110, 11000000
CMY 0.502, 0.318, 0.247
CMYK 34, 9, 0, 25

Color spaces of #7FAEC0 Glacier - RGB(127, 174, 192)

HSV (or HSB) 197°, 34°, 75°
HSL 197°, 34°, 63°
Web Safe #6699cc
XYZ 33.403, 38.590, 55.557
CIE-Lab 68.453, -11.176, -14.208
xyY 0.262, 0.303, 38.590
Decimal 8367808

What does RGB 127,174,192 mean?

The RGB color 127, 174, 192 represents a dull and muted shade of Blue. The websafe version of this color is hex 6699cc. This color might be commonly referred to as a shade similar to Glacier.
